Hi everyone,

This question might have a very simple answer, but I can't find it anywhere.

I want to save (export ?) hundreds of handpicked radio stations I've gathered in my VLC media library and install those
in the latest VLC player. I'm currently using 1.1.12 The Luggage. An update would probably do the trick,
but I prefer to uninstall the older version before I move to the newest.
Does anybody know how to save or export them ?

Help is needed, I'd hate to lose them.

The media library is saved on upgrade, but if you want a backup, select the "Media Library", and do File→Save Playlist to File.

Hmm, start VLC fresh, go to Media Library, Ctrl-A, drag them to Playlist, then try "Save Playlist to File"?
